The interim proxy (#239/#240/#242/#243) covers the day-one needs for Overpass — User-Agent compliance via server-side proxy, same-origin + rate limit + cache with coalescing, bbox quantization, observability. Further work on self-hosting the upstream is no longer urgent. Move the full OpenSpec artifact set out of openspec/changes/ so it doesn't clutter the active change list, and park it under docs/ideas/self-host-overpass/ as a reference for when we revive it. Adds a short README at the new location capturing: - current interim solution - triggers that would justify reviving (rate limits, >1 req/s, etc.) - key decisions already made (Hetzner-to-Hetzner firewall model, DOCKER-USER chain, capacity ceiling at DACH on current box) - how to switch when the time comes (flip OVERPASS_URL, no client changes) The files were never committed in the first place (WIP in the working tree through the proposal session), so no git history to preserve. 3. Firewall (Docker-aware)
- 3.1 Write an nftables / iptables rule template using the
DOCKER-USERchain: ACCEPT from<PLANNER_HOST_IP>to the overpass port on the public interface, DROP everything else on that port - 3.2 Load the Planner host IP from a local env file on the Overpass host (e.g.
/etc/overpass/planner-ip.env) — do NOT check the IP into the repo - 3.3 Add a
scripts/apply-firewall.shthat renders the rule template, applies it, and persists across reboots (systemd unit ornftables.conf) - 3.4 Verify rules survive
systemctl restart dockeranddocker compose restartwithout clobbering - 3.5 Verify an outside host (e.g. laptop home IP) cannot connect to the overpass port; verify the Planner host can
4. Planner proxy route
- 4.1 Create
apps/planner/app/routes/api.overpass.tsas a React Router action that accepts POST with an Overpass QL body - 4.2 Read the upstream URL from
OVERPASS_URLenv var; return 503 with a clear log message when unset or empty - 4.3 Enforce session + same-origin: reuse the Planner's existing session cookie check; reject cross-origin with 403
- 4.4 Stream the upstream response body and status back to the caller; pass through 429s as-is
- 4.5 Add unit tests covering 401 (no session), 403 (cross-origin), 503 (unset
OVERPASS_URL), and happy-path forwarding (mock upstream)
